adj. Without oxygen; especially of an environment or organism.
adj. Of, or relating to an anaerobe

adj. Not requiring air or oxygen for life; -- applied especially to those microbes to which free oxygen is unnecessary; anaërobiotic; -- opposed to aërobic.
adj. Relating to, or like, anaërobies; anaërobiotic.
